City staff warns US‑33 widening and interchange projects will shift maintenance and affect local access

Canal Winchester City Council · November 4, 2025

City Administrator Matt Peoples and staff briefed council on an extensive ODOT update: Pickerington Road interchange, US‑33 widening, Bixby Road interchange planning, ramp metering on Gender Road, and an ODOT proposal that the city assume maintenance responsibilities for US‑33 after the widening and warranty period.

City Administrator Matt Peoples and staff gave a detailed update Nov. 3 on Ohio Department of Transportation projects affecting Canal Winchester and the US‑33 corridor.
